Description

The churchyard gates, gate piers, and walls surrounding St James' Church in Teignmouth were built in 1821, with some later 19th-century modifications. The walls are made of red sandstone rubble, while the gate piers feature limestone caps and are accompanied by cast-iron and wrought-iron gates.

Substantial gate piers flank the path about 20 meters from the west door, topped with stepped shallow pyramidal caps that support cast-iron gates approximately 2 meters high. These gates resemble long and short railings but include interlacing tracery on the central horizontal bar, with spade-head tops and arrow-head tops on the upper rails, which are square in section. Additionally, 20th-century segmental steel arches bolted to the top of each gate have pointed spikes.

The wall extends around 35 meters to the north, turns east for about 25 meters, then turns north again for approximately 6 meters before turning east once more for about 6 meters. In the angle formed is the tomb of Thomas Luny. The wall descends the hill for about 70 meters to meet the north-east corner of the church. Approximately 10 meters from the north end are double wrought-iron gates, also about 2 meters high, featuring square-section long and short rails with heavy arrow heads on the upper and lower rails.

A curved revetment wall connects the south-east corner of the church to the west gates, enclosing the south side of the churchyard. This wall extends about 110 meters, and approximately 27 meters from the east end is a long and short-railed gate with steps.
